    Financing for Framing Contractors

    Companies that specialize in commercial and residential framing are an integral part of a construction project. Framing contractors work from design through completion and work with other specialty subcontractors throughout the process. There is a collaboration with electricians, plumbers, and other subs to ensure that the framing design meets the specifications required for the project. With the project also comes a list of expenses that are incurred at the beginning of the project and will continue to tie up cash flow until completion.

    How to use a Framing Contractor Loan

    There’s a lot to consider when choosing the framing contractor loan program that’s right for your business. There are needs that require lump sums of capital when a project begins and others that require flexibility as a project is being completed. Turning to a line of credit for framing contractors provides standby capital for ongoing projects.
